diff --git a/CHANGELOG.asciidoc b/CHANGELOG.asciidoc index 06eb08cfb729..cebb87ce771f 100644 --- a/CHANGELOG.asciidoc +++ b/CHANGELOG.asciidoc @@ -311,6 +311,7 @@ https://github.com/elastic/beats/compare/v6.2.3...master[Check the HEAD diff] - Add support for bearer token files to HTTP helper. {pull}7527[7527] - Add Elasticsearch index recovery metricset. {pull}7225[7225] - Run Kafka integration tests on version 1.1.0 {pull}7616[7616] +- Release raid and socket metricset from system module as GA. {pull}7658[7658] *Packetbeat* diff --git a/metricbeat/docs/modules/system/raid.asciidoc b/metricbeat/docs/modules/system/raid.asciidoc index f172194edbd3..8a90a2fe31c1 100644 --- a/metricbeat/docs/modules/system/raid.asciidoc +++ b/metricbeat/docs/modules/system/raid.asciidoc @@ -5,8 +5,6 @@ This file is generated! See scripts/docs_collector.py [[metricbeat-metricset-system-raid]] === System raid metricset -beta[] - include::../../../module/system/raid/_meta/docs.asciidoc[] diff --git a/metricbeat/docs/modules/system/socket.asciidoc b/metricbeat/docs/modules/system/socket.asciidoc index 9f399ac2f663..117c0532d9af 100644 --- a/metricbeat/docs/modules/system/socket.asciidoc +++ b/metricbeat/docs/modules/system/socket.asciidoc @@ -5,8 +5,6 @@ This file is generated! See scripts/docs_collector.py [[metricbeat-metricset-system-socket]] === System socket metricset -beta[] - include::../../../module/system/socket/_meta/docs.asciidoc[] diff --git a/metricbeat/docs/modules_list.asciidoc b/metricbeat/docs/modules_list.asciidoc index 015bea036d56..809bab134b9d 100644 --- a/metricbeat/docs/modules_list.asciidoc +++ b/metricbeat/docs/modules_list.asciidoc @@ -124,8 +124,8 @@ This file is generated! See scripts/docs_collector.py |<> |<> |<> -|<> beta[] -|<> beta[] +|<> +|<> |<> |<> experimental[] |image:./images/icon-no.png[No prebuilt dashboards] | .1+| .1+| |<> experimental[] diff --git a/metricbeat/module/system/fields.go b/metricbeat/module/system/fields.go index e5d1849ae2c7..00c32a6d4dc4 100644 --- a/metricbeat/module/system/fields.go +++ b/metricbeat/module/system/fields.go @@ -31,5 +31,5 @@ func init() { // Asset returns asset data func Asset() string { - return "" + return "" } diff --git a/metricbeat/module/system/raid/_meta/docs.asciidoc b/metricbeat/module/system/raid/_meta/docs.asciidoc index 6544b9da5993..0fca78be090a 100644 --- a/metricbeat/module/system/raid/_meta/docs.asciidoc +++ b/metricbeat/module/system/raid/_meta/docs.asciidoc @@ -1,3 +1,5 @@ === system raid MetricSet -This is the raid metricset of the module system. +This is the raid metricset of the module system. It collects stats about the raid. + +The config option `raid.mount_point:` can be used to configure the raid mount point. diff --git a/metricbeat/module/system/raid/_meta/fields.yml b/metricbeat/module/system/raid/_meta/fields.yml index 3a06b22027d0..35c6e2421825 100644 --- a/metricbeat/module/system/raid/_meta/fields.yml +++ b/metricbeat/module/system/raid/_meta/fields.yml @@ -2,7 +2,7 @@ type: group description: > raid - release: beta + release: ga fields: - name: name type: keyword diff --git a/metricbeat/module/system/raid/raid.go b/metricbeat/module/system/raid/raid.go index e1050bddf406..16f1475eab97 100644 --- a/metricbeat/module/system/raid/raid.go +++ b/metricbeat/module/system/raid/raid.go @@ -24,7 +24,6 @@ import ( "github.com/prometheus/procfs" "github.com/elastic/beats/libbeat/common" - "github.com/elastic/beats/libbeat/common/cfgwarn" "github.com/elastic/beats/metricbeat/mb" "github.com/elastic/beats/metricbeat/mb/parse" "github.com/elastic/beats/metricbeat/module/system" @@ -44,8 +43,6 @@ type MetricSet struct { // New creates a new instance of the raid metricset. func New(base mb.BaseMetricSet) (mb.MetricSet, error) { - cfgwarn.Beta("The system raid metricset is beta") - systemModule, ok := base.Module().(*system.Module) if !ok { return nil, errors.New("unexpected module type") diff --git a/metricbeat/module/system/socket/_meta/fields.yml b/metricbeat/module/system/socket/_meta/fields.yml index 0a34d09a53a4..a75af1a9159c 100644 --- a/metricbeat/module/system/socket/_meta/fields.yml +++ b/metricbeat/module/system/socket/_meta/fields.yml @@ -2,7 +2,7 @@ type: group description: > TCP sockets that are active. - release: beta + release: ga fields: - name: direction type: keyword diff --git a/metricbeat/module/system/socket/socket.go b/metricbeat/module/system/socket/socket.go index 524eb3783921..7c45df08b7a1 100644 --- a/metricbeat/module/system/socket/socket.go +++ b/metricbeat/module/system/socket/socket.go @@ -28,7 +28,6 @@ import ( "syscall" "github.com/elastic/beats/libbeat/common" - "github.com/elastic/beats/libbeat/common/cfgwarn" "github.com/elastic/beats/libbeat/logp" "github.com/elastic/beats/metricbeat/mb" "github.com/elastic/beats/metricbeat/mb/parse" @@ -63,8 +62,6 @@ type MetricSet struct { } func New(base mb.BaseMetricSet) (mb.MetricSet, error) { - cfgwarn.Beta("The system collector metricset is beta") - c := defaultConfig if err := base.Module().UnpackConfig(&c); err != nil { return nil, err